Member: 163 Status: Offline Thanks Meter: 7,777 | there is a bunch of things to try before yelling on support, like : - retry with FULLY CHARGED, ORIGINAL battery - open phone and check battery contacts for desolder/bad solder - check BSI line - check USB cable - check USB connector and lines on the phone, if needed - replace it - use another PC to retry flashing if still the same - reflow CPU/Flash memory combo gently. aand ... if still the same ... phone is ready for trash bin, mainboard just got cracked somewhere, nothing to do about that. (or ram/flash memory, maybe even cpu simply died of age/usage). b.r. Alex
